    I have had A Cobray M-11 9mm and it Sucked trigger slap was Awful .It was picky About what it would eat. I sold it this was in 92

    In 1988 I also Had a Intertec arms KG-99 (Tec-9) While I heard good things about the Open bolt version .The closed Bolt Version I got would Jam every 3 rounds Like Clock work the Case would turn side ways.and get smashed into the Breech ,cut my fingers many times trying to Un-jam it.

    My Moms Boy friend stole it which in my book was a Blessing
    I got My first Poly-Tech Legend after that

    I would go with a Scorpion that is Just a Better Option In My Book .Out of what you want .

    KAL I believe Vector Has a Uzi that Accepts Grease Gun Mags in 45 and is around 700.I would save My pennies and go that route.

    Just My 2 cents
